Polonius Press is a small publisher located in the Hampton Roads region of southeastern Virginia. The principals are
Brenda Joyner and Rick Bodson, cancer survivors dedicated to community service on several fronts.

Our first book,
Chemo Sabe, was authored by Brenda to capture and share the experiences of supporting a person
going through a chemotherapy and radiation treatment. It deals in data, tackling cancer as a project to be managed and
exercising as much control as possible over what is a very scary and emotional time in your life.
Chemo Sabe is intended
to equip the cancer patient's Personal Advocate (be it a single person or a team) with tips, techniques and suggestions
to get through the weeks and months of chemo and radiation. Se

Our second effort,
Isle of Wight 1708-2007, was to manage the re-publication of Col. E. M. Morrison's 1907 brief history
of our County. With an update of the last 100 years authored by Doris Gwaltney, the republication is a Jamestown 2007
project of the Isle of Wight Branch of APVA Preservation Virginia.
